就是contains这个函数,书上介绍说这个函数是按照元素的内容来来筛选选择的元素集,当我运行代码的时候老是报错,后来发现是函数库里没有这个函数,于是自己写了这个函数。
代码如下:
复制代码 代码如下:
function yhcheckisincludingvalue(element , pattern文章博客)
{
var bool = fal;
var childrennodes = element.childnodes;
if (childrennodes.length == 0)
{
if (element.nodevalue != null)
{
if (pattern.exec(element.nodevalue) != null)
师范生实习总结{
return true;
}
}
}
if (childrennodes.length != 0)
{
for (var i = 0 ; i < childrennodes.length ; i++)
{
if (bool = yhcheckisincludingvalue(childrennodes , patter面积最大的湖泊n)) break;
}
}
return bool;
}
//在函数链应用这个函数
$.fn.contains = function(text)
{
var text = $.trim(tex爱情哲理名言t);
if (text == ‘undefined’) return this;
var pattern = new regexp(text , ‘i’);
return this.filter(f专科是不是大专unction(){
return yhcheckisincludingvalue(this , pattern);
});
}
在ie浏览器上运行正常,不知道其他的浏览器会出现什么情况?
本文发布于:2023-04-06 14:10:28,感谢您对本站的认可!
本文链接:https://www.wtabcd.cn/fanwen/zuowen/0d2e79e723f2512cdbd52b2f17306749.html
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。
本文word下载地址:php实现jQuery扩展函数.doc
本文 PDF 下载地址:php实现jQuery扩展函数.pdf
留言与评论(共有 0 条评论) |